The evening begins at 7:00 PM with a reading by our featured poet, followed by open mic readings for anyone who wants to share their work. Sign up for open mic when you arrive and wait for your turn to read.
September Featured Poet – Elizabeth S. Wolf:
Wolf has published 5 books of poetry, including her chapbook Did You Know?, winner of the 2018 Rattle Prize. Her work has been featured in the White House, US Capitol, and the Poetry in Motion Festival, and selected works are part of the Lunar Codex archive on the Moon.
October Featured Poet - Bob Whelan
Whelan is the Poet Laureate of Rockport, MA, with work published in journals and anthologies and translated into several languages. A passionate spoken-word poet, he performs at open mics locally, nationally, and internationally. He organizes the Rockport Poetry Festival and hosts monthly open mics in Rockport and Gloucester. His honors include a silver medal at the 2022 Naoussa International Poetry Festival and a poem included in NASA’s 2025 Lunar Codex Project. He holds an MS in Counseling Psychology and an MFA in Creative Writing.
November Featured Poet - Ellie O'Leary
O’Leary is a New England writer who grew up in Freedom, Maine, and went on to become the Poet Laureate Emerita of Amesbury, Massachusetts. She is a member of the Amesbury Cultural Council, and she co-chairs the Poet Laureate Support Committee. Her books are Breathe Here (Poetry, 2020) and Up Home Again (Memoir, 2023), published by North Country Press.
